`crystals.KirillovReshetikhin` is a general entry point to create KR
crystals, whereas `crystals.kirillov_reshetikhin` is a catalog of the
models for KR crystals. I've changed the function
`KirillovReshetikhinCrystal` to be the entry point function in the
catalog. I've also moved the `kir_resh.RiggedConfigurations` into
`rigged_configurations.py` and fixed the doc error.
